Collocations of chop

chop wood
Frequency: 80 %

He used an axe to chop wood for the fireplace.

chop vegetables
Frequency: 70 %

She carefully chopped vegetables for the stir-fry.

chop meat
Frequency: 65 %

The chef expertly chopped the meat for the stew.

chop onions
Frequency: 60 %

The recipe called for finely chopped onions.

chop hair
Frequency: 50 %

She decided to chop her long hair into a stylish bob.

Idiomatic Expressions for chop

  • Phrase: chop suey
    Meaning: A dish in Chinese cuisine consisting of meat, eggs, and vegetables cooked together.
    Usage: I ordered the chop suey for lunch because I was craving Chinese food.
